Adding something around fixes.
A final release would not receive any backported bug fixes. For those that
want supported versions there is RH-SSO.
We should however do backporting of critical security issues. We would only
backport security fixes to the current Final release.
So we could have the following releases:
* 4.0.0.Beta1/2/3
* 4.0.0.Final
* 4.1.0.Beta1/2/3
* 4.1.0.Final
* 4.2.0.Beta1
* 4.1.1.Final (to include a single critical security vulnerability, note
there would be no 4.0.1.Final)
